Earth Day, celebrated annually on April 22nd, is a global event dedicated to raising awareness about environmental issues and promoting sustainable practices. To mark this significant day, many organizations, schools, and individuals create Earth Day certificates to acknowledge and reward eco-friendly initiatives. This article provides a comprehensive guide on creating an engaging and informative Earth Day certificate template.
Understanding Earth Day Certificates
Earth Day certificates serve as a powerful tool to inspire and motivate people to take action for the environment. They can be awarded to individuals, teams, or organizations that have demonstrated exceptional commitment to environmental conservation, sustainability, or have achieved significant eco-friendly milestones.

Essential Elements of an Earth Day Certificate Template
To create a well-rounded Earth Day certificate, ensure your template includes the following essential elements:

- Header: Include the Earth Day logo or a relevant image to immediately communicate the purpose of the certificate.
- Recipient Information: Leave space to write the name of the recipient, as well as their organization or team (if applicable).
- Achievement Description: Clearly state the reason for the award, describing the recipient's eco-friendly actions or achievements.
- Date: Include the date of the award to provide context and help preserve the certificate's historical significance.
- Signature: Add a space for the presenter's signature, along with their title or position (e.g., "Principal, Green Meadows Elementary School").

Printing and Distributing Earth Day Certificates
Once you've designed and finalized your Earth Day certificate template, it's time to print and distribute them. Opt for eco-friendly printing options, such as using recycled paper or printing locally to minimize your carbon footprint.
Distribute the certificates during Earth Day events, assemblies, or through email as digital certificates. Encourage recipients to share their awards on social media using the hashtag #EarthDay to raise awareness and inspire others to take action for the environment.
